1. Outdated Roofs Lose Heat Fast
Older conservatory roofs – especially polycarbonate or single-pane glass—offer minimal insulation. They allow heat to escape rapidly in colder months, and trap it excessively in summer, forcing you to rely on electric heaters, fans, or air conditioning.
This lack of insulation means higher energy bills and less useable living space.

3. Reduce Your Heating Bills
By upgrading to a new, insulated conservatory roof, you drastically cut heat loss from your home. This means your central heating system doesn’t have to work as hard, helping to lower your energy consumption and carbon footprint.
Over time, this investment can pay for itself through reduced utility bills – especially with rising energy prices in the UK.
